What are the solutions to X2 + 8X + 7 = 0?

Sagot :

Answer:

x = - 7, x = - 1

Step-by-step explanation:

Given

x² + 8x + 7 = 0

Consider the factors of the constant term (+ 7) which sum to give the coefficient of the x- term (+ 8)

The factors are + 7 and + 1 , since

7 × 1 = 7 and 7 + 1 = 8 , then

(x + 7)(x + 1) = 0 ← in factored form

Equate each factor to zero and solve for x

x + 7 = 0 ⇒ x = - 7

x + 1 = 0 ⇒ x = - 1
